chainsaw
Build chainable fluent interfaces the easy way... with a freakin' chainsaw!
Found 44 results for monadic
Build chainable fluent interfaces the easy way... with a freakin' chainsaw!
FantasyLand compliant (monadic) alternative to Promises
Turn non-concurrent FantasyLand Applicatives concurrent
Reactive programming with lean, functions-only, curried, tree-shakeable API
Monadic streams
Reactive programming with lean, functions-only, curried, tree-shakeable API
Reactive programming with lean, functions-only, curried, tree-shakeable API
Reactive programming with lean, functions-only, curried, tree-shakeable API
Simple Java8-inspired monadic class to represent optional values
Most.js based middleware for Redux. Handle async actions with monadic streams and reactive programming.
Simple TypeScript/ES2017 class to represent either values
Functional parsing library
Tiny goodies for Continuation-Passing-Style functions
A pure functional keyboard navigation framework with mathematically sound foundations
Experimental implementation of Maybe and Result monads compatible with await.
utility module, immutable type validator & Erlang/Elixir style guards ( but with every imaginable method ).
Monadic binding for Svelte stores
A tiny, TypeScript-first, result/error handling utility.
K-Stream is a functional reactive stream library for TypeScript
A TypeScript utility library for handling error and result types with a fluent chaining API
Monads in JavaScript
Utilities for monadic promises.
Monadic parser combinator
Monadic Parser Combinators
A TypeScript monad library with only the things you'll actually use.
Functions for monadic promises.
Option monad implementation for JS
type validator & Erlang/Elixir style guards.
Lightweight monadic abstraction to 'purely' handle side effects in javascript.
🐛 Monadic Error Handling for JavaScript/TypeScript.
Fantasy Land compatible types for easy integration with functional javascript libraries like ramda. This library benifits by having no dependencies
util.promisify but for Tasks !
Scala like for-yield for JavaScript
Monadic bottom-up parser combinator library.
Experimental implementation of Maybe and Result monads compatible with await.
pull style lazy combinators for monadic containers
Fluture-js based middleware for Redux. Handle async actions with FantasyLand compliant Futures, a lazy, monadic alternative to Promises.
Provides Result and Optional monads, inspired by railway oriented programming.
Monad with do notation in Javascript, using ES6 generators.
A monadic interface for sqlite in Node.
ParseRiver: a monadic parser library for TypeScript and JavaScript
Monadic logging
Bound Monadic Parser Combinators
Most.js based middleware for Redux. Handle async actions with monadic streams and reactive programming.